About ALBEMARLE CORP

Albemarle Corporation manufactures specialty chemicals and energy storage materials for industrial and consumer applications. The company's primary focus is lithium compounds—including lithium carbonate, lithium hydroxide, and lithium chloride—which are essential inputs for lithium-ion batteries used in electric vehicles, consumer electronics, grid storage systems, and renewable energy applications. Beyond lithium, Albemarle produces bromine-based specialty chemicals, high-performance greases, catalyst solutions, and zirconium and titanium products for pyrotechnical applications.

The company operates three main segments: Energy Storage, which generates revenue from lithium compounds and related materials; Specialties, which encompasses bromine chemicals, lithium solutions for non-battery applications, cesium products, and pharmaceutical intermediates; and Ketjen, which supplies catalysts for refining and petrochemical processes, including hydroprocessing and fluidized catalytic cracking catalysts. The company serves end markets including automotive, aerospace, conventional energy, electronics, construction, agriculture, pharmaceuticals, and medical devices.

Albemarle employs approximately 7,800 full-time workers and operates on a global basis. Founded in 1887 and head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, the company is incorporated in Virginia and listed on the NYSE with a market capitalization of $21.1 billion.
